Subject: Formula sandbox cut-over — done

Hi all,

We flipped Tallyfox over to the new sandbox for user-supplied formulas last night. All evaluation now runs in the isolated worker pool with no filesystem or network access, and per-formula CPU/memory caps are enforced. Legacy eval path is fully removed, not just disabled. No regressions in the overnight batch. For the audit, the sandbox is running with the following settings.

deployment values, fafog-fawip:
[jorox]
team = fendor
access_code = ac_bb00ea
host = jorox.qorveltech.internal
port = 9200
owner = istdor.aldeth
peer = julvan.orvexlabs.internal

Ticket: Static-analysis baseline file drifts after formatter runs. Repro: check out main in the Gravelin repo, run the formatter, then run the analyzer — 37 spurious new findings appear because line offsets in the baseline no longer match. Expected: baseline updates atomically with formatting. Workaround: regenerate the baseline via the admin endpoint, which requires the credential below.

session JWT of yawep-yawep = eyJhbGciOiJIUzI1NiIsInR5cCI6IkpXVCJ9.eyJzdWIiOiI3pWF3_In0.aXYsHiog

# Limits and Quotas — Squintguard Scanner

Squintguard scans registry uploads for typo-squatting against popular package names. Plugin authors should note that each plugin runs inside a shared analysis budget: per-package time, candidate-name comparisons, and registry lookups are all metered. Plugins exceeding a quota are skipped for that package and logged, not retried. The enforced values, applied uniformly across all third-party plugins, are listed below.

tuning constants:
QUOTAS = {
    "druwyn": 5,
    "holix": 5,
    "zorath": 5,
    "holwyn": 10,
}